Why AC Problems Don't Stay at the Same Level in Ames, TX

Every AC component failure creates secondary stress on adjacent components that accelerates their deterioration in Ames. A failing capacitor causes the compressor to struggle to start, producing heat and mechanical stress on the compressor with every startup attempt in Ames, TX. Low refrigerant causes the compressor to run hotter than designed, accelerating compressor wear in Ames. A dirty condenser coil causes the system to run at elevated head pressure, stressing the compressor and the refrigerant circuit in Ames, TX. In each case, the initial fault produces secondary damage to more expensive components if not addressed when first identified in Ames.

Common A/C Problems We Fix

Common A/C Problems Air America Diagnoses and Repairs in Ames, TX

AC Not Cooling or Blowing Warm Air in Ames

An AC system that is running but blowing warm or room-temperature air has a specific failure in the refrigerant circuit or the condenser in Ames, TX. Low refrigerant from a leak is the most common cause in Ames. A failed condenser fan that is allowing the condenser coil to overheat is another common cause in Ames, TX. A failed compressor is a less common but more significant cause in Ames. Air America diagnoses the specific cause through refrigerant pressure testing and component assessment before recommending any repair in Ames, TX.

AC Running Constantly Without Reaching Setpoint in Ames, TX

An AC system running continuously without reaching the thermostat setpoint is a system whose cooling output does not match the cooling load of the home in Ames. This can result from low refrigerant reducing the system's cooling capacity, a dirty condenser coil reducing heat rejection efficiency, an undersized system for the home's actual cooling load, or an air distribution problem preventing conditioned air from reaching the thermostat location in Ames, TX. Air America identifies the specific cause before recommending any solution in Ames.

AC Short Cycling — Turning On and Off Frequently in Ames

An AC system that turns on, runs for a few minutes, and turns off repeatedly without completing a full cooling cycle is short cycling in Ames, TX. Causes include a failing capacitor that cannot sustain the compressor through a full cycle, an oversized system that cools the thermostat location before the rest of the home reaches setpoint, a refrigerant overcharge or undercharge causing safety switch trips, or a dirty air filter causing the evaporator coil to freeze and trigger freeze protection in Ames.

AC Not Turning On at All in Ames, TX

An AC system that will not start has a specific electrical or control fault preventing startup in Ames. Failed capacitor. Tripped breaker. Failed contactor. Failed control board. Thermostat wiring fault. Air America diagnoses no-start conditions through systematic electrical testing beginning with the most common and least expensive causes in Ames, TX.

AC Making Unusual Noises in Ames

Specific sounds correspond to specific developing mechanical faults in Ames, TX. Grinding or squealing from the air handler indicates a failing blower motor bearing in Ames. Rattling from the outdoor unit may indicate debris in the condenser fan or a loose component in Ames, TX. Banging or clanking from the compressor indicates an internal compressor fault in Ames. Bubbling or hissing indicates refrigerant escaping through a leak in Ames, TX.

AC Leaking Water or Refrigerant in Ames, TX

Water leaking from the indoor air handler typically indicates a clogged condensate drain line in Ames. A clogged drain causes the condensate pan to overflow, producing water damage to the surrounding structure in Ames, TX. Refrigerant leaking from the system produces a hissing sound and typically a loss of cooling capacity as the refrigerant level drops in Ames. Air America addresses both as same-day urgent repairs in Ames, TX.

AC Freezing Up in Ames

A frozen evaporator coil indicates either restricted airflow or low refrigerant in Ames, TX. A dirty air filter, blocked return grilles, or a failing blower can all cause the coil to freeze in Ames. Low refrigerant causes the coil temperature to drop below freezing in Ames, TX. A frozen coil should not be forced to operate. Turn the system to fan-only mode to allow the ice to melt before Air America's technician diagnoses and addresses the underlying cause in Ames.

What Causes AC Failures

What Causes AC Systems to Fail in Ames, TX

Refrigerant Leaks and Low Refrigerant in Ames

Refrigerant does not deplete under normal operation in Ames, TX. Low refrigerant indicates a leak in the refrigerant circuit in Ames. The leak must be found and repaired before refrigerant is added, or the added refrigerant leaks out and the problem recurs in Ames, TX. Air America locates leaks using electronic leak detection equipment, repairs the leak, and recharges to the manufacturer's specified charge in Ames.

Dirty or Blocked Condenser Coils in Ames, TX

The condenser coil rejects heat extracted from the home to the outdoor air in Ames. A coil coated in dirt, debris, and cottonwood reduces heat rejection capacity in Ames, TX. The system runs at elevated head pressure, reducing efficiency and increasing compressor wear in Ames. Air America cleans condenser coils using appropriate products that restore performance without damaging the fins in Ames, TX.

Failed Capacitors and Contactors in Ames

Capacitors provide the electrical boost that starts the compressor and condenser fan motor in Ames, TX. A failing or failed capacitor causes the compressor or fan to struggle to start or fail to start entirely in Ames. Capacitor failure is one of the most common AC repairs and one of the most straightforward to address in Ames, TX. A failed contactor prevents the outdoor unit from operating regardless of the thermostat signal in Ames.

Frozen Evaporator Coil From Restricted Airflow in Ames, TX

The evaporator coil requires adequate airflow to prevent refrigerant from dropping below freezing temperature in Ames. A dirty filter, blocked return grilles, or a failing blower can cause the coil to freeze in Ames, TX. The ice buildup progressively blocks all airflow and eventually shuts the system down completely in Ames.

Compressor Failure in Ames

The compressor is the most expensive single component in the AC system in Ames, TX. Compressor failure typically results from long-term operation under abnormal conditions including low refrigerant, dirty condenser coils, or failed capacitors in Ames. A failed compressor requires replacement in Ames, TX. The cost relative to system age and condition is the primary repair versus replace consideration in Ames.

Clogged Condensate Drain in Ames, TX

The condensate drain removes the water extracted from indoor air during cooling operation in Ames. The drain pan and line can accumulate algae, mold, and debris that produces a blockage in Ames, TX. A clogged drain causes the pan to overflow and water to leak onto the surrounding structure in Ames. Air America clears clogged drains and treats the line with biocide to prevent rapid reoccurrence in Ames, TX.

Pricing

A/C System Repair Cost in Ames, TX

All pricing confirmed upfront before work begins in Ames. No surprises in Ames, TX.

Capacitor replacement in Ames$150 to $350
Contactor replacement in Ames, TX$150 to $300
Refrigerant leak repair and recharge in Ames$400 to $1,200
Condensate drain cleaning in Ames, TX$100 to $250
Condenser coil cleaning in Ames$150 to $350
Control board replacement in Ames, TX$300 to $700
Compressor replacement in Ames$1,200 to $2,500+
Evaporator coil replacement in Ames, TX$800 to $1,800

The repair versus replace decision depends on the repair cost relative to the system's remaining useful life in Ames. A $200 capacitor replacement on a 5-year-old system is straightforward to justify in Ames, TX. A $2,000 compressor replacement on a 15-year-old system approaching end of designed service life warrants a more careful comparison with replacement cost in Ames. Air America provides an honest assessment of the system's condition and remaining life as part of every major repair recommendation in Ames, TX.

Most common AC repairs including capacitor replacement, contactor replacement, and condensate drain clearing take one to two hours in Ames. More complex repairs including refrigerant leak location and repair, control board replacement, and evaporator coil replacement take two to four hours or more depending on access and complexity in Ames, TX.
It depends on the specific repair cost and the system's age and condition in Ames. A rule of thumb is that if the repair cost exceeds 50 percent of the cost of a comparable new system and the existing system is more than 10 years old, replacement warrants serious consideration in Ames, TX. Air America provides an honest assessment of the system's condition and remaining life alongside every major repair recommendation in Ames.
Yes. A severely restricted air filter reduces the airflow through the evaporator coil below the minimum needed for correct operation in Ames. The coil drops below freezing and ice builds on the coil surface in Ames, TX. The ice buildup progressively blocks all airflow and eventually causes the system to shut down completely in Ames. Replacing the filter allows the ice to melt and the system to restart in most cases in Ames, TX.
A capacitor is an electrical component that provides the high-voltage boost needed to start the compressor and condenser fan motors in Ames. A failing capacitor causes the motors to struggle to start, producing a humming sound and excessive heat in the motor in Ames, TX. A failed capacitor causes the motor to fail to start entirely in Ames. Capacitor failure is one of the most common AC repair situations and one of the most straightforward to correct in Ames, TX.
Water leaking from the indoor air handler typically indicates a clogged condensate drain line in Ames. The condensate pan overflows when the drain cannot remove the water the evaporator coil is extracting from the air in Ames, TX. A cracked or damaged condensate pan is a less common cause in Ames. Water leaking from the outdoor unit in cooling mode is not normal and may indicate a refrigerant issue in Ames, TX.
